Tightening the E Brake: Why It’s Important
The E-brake is designed to provide an additional layer of safety in emergency situations, such as when a driver needs to stop quickly or when the primary brakes fail. When the E-brake is functioning properly, it can help to prevent accidents and reduce the risk of injury or damage. However, if the E-brake is not functioning properly, it can increase the risk of accidents and put the driver and other road users at risk.
There are several reasons why the E-brake may need to be tightened, including:
- Wear and tear: Over time, the E-brake can wear out and lose its effectiveness, which is why it is essential to check and tighten it regularly.
- Improper use: If the E-brake is used excessively or improperly, it can cause wear and tear on the brake components, leading to a loss of effectiveness.
- Corrosion: Moisture and salt can cause corrosion on the E-brake components, which can lead to a loss of effectiveness.

Common Problems with E Brakes
There are several common problems that can occur with E brakes, including:
Worn Out Brake Pads
Worn out brake pads can cause the E-brake to malfunction, leading to a loss of effectiveness. It is essential to check the brake pads regularly and replace them as needed.
Corrosion
Corrosion can cause the E-brake components to rust and fail, leading to a loss of effectiveness. It is essential to clean and lubricate the E-brake components regularly to prevent corrosion.
Improper Use
